# Subagent System
The subagent system allows a parent agent to spawn isolated child agents that run tasks in parallel and report results back automatically.

## Key Files
| File | Purpose |
|------|---------|
| `sessions-spawn.ts` | Tool: spawns a child agent with task, label, timeout, provider |
| `sessions-list.ts` | Tool: lists subagent runs and their status |
| `registry.ts` | Lifecycle management: register, watch, capture, announce, archive |
| `announce.ts` | System prompt builder, findings reader, message formatter, delivery |
| `announce-queue.ts` | Debounced queue for batching announcements when parent is busy |
| `command-queue.ts` | Concurrency limiter for subagent lane slots |
| `lanes.ts` | Lane config: max concurrency (10), default timeout (600s) |
| `types.ts` | Shared types: SubagentRunRecord, SubagentRunOutcome, etc. |
| `registry-store.ts` | Persistence: save/load runs to disk for crash recovery |
## Provider Inheritance
Subagents inherit the parent's resolved LLM provider:
```
runner.ts (resolvedProvider)
→ toolsOptions.provider
→ tools.ts (CreateToolsOptions.provider)
→ sessions-spawn.ts (options.provider)
→ hub.createSubagent({ provider })
```
When the user switches providers via UI (`setProvider()`), `toolsOptions.provider` is updated in sync so future spawns use the new provider.
## Error Propagation
```
Child tool error (e.g., API 401)
→ Subagent LLM sees error, includes in final message (system prompt rule)
→ captureFindings() reads final message
→ Announcement includes error in findings
→ Parent LLM sees error and can inform user
Child run error (e.g., missing API key for provider)
→ AsyncAgent._lastRunError set
→ registry.ts checks childAgent.lastRunError after waitForIdle()
→ outcome = { status: "error", error: "No API key configured..." }
→ Announcement: "task failed: No API key configured..."
```
## Timeout Behavior
Default: 600s (10 min). System prompt guides the parent LLM:
- Simple tasks: 600s (default)
- Moderate tasks: 900-1200s (15-20 min)
- Complex tasks: 1200-1800s (20-30 min)
On timeout:
1. Timeout timer fires in `watchChildAgent()`
2. `cleanup({ status: "timeout" })` is called
3. Child agent is closed via `hub.closeAgent()`
4. Findings are captured from whatever the child wrote so far
5. Announcement reports "timed out" with partial findings
